Megan Markle is now a start-up investor

Megan Markle is expanding her influence by becoming an investor, Fox News can confirm.

The 39-year-old Duchess of Sussex has personally invested in Clever Blends, a woman-established business. It is run by co-founder and CEO Hannah Mendoza and makes instant oat milk lattes.

“This investment is in favor of an aspiring female entrepreneur who prioritizes building community with her business,” Markle said in a statement received by Fox News. Love personally and have a holistic approach to health. I trust her, I trust her company. “

Originally started as a pop-up coffee bar in Santa Barbara, California, Cleaver Late blends are now sold online, and the company donates one percent of its revenue to organizations fighting for food justice in the United States

The Duchess’ personal investment will help measure Mendoza’s mission to create environmentally friendly, plant – based products and support their shared interest in sustainable food initiatives in the community.

“Entrepreneurs need funding, but they also need consultants who are deeply concerned about what they are creating. I’m grateful to have found both in Duchess of Sussex,” Mendoza told Fox News. . We are happy with the way forward. “
